It s part of an emerging industry that s trying to cash in on a senseless human problem: The huge amount of uneaten food that goes from supermarkets and restaurants to the dumpster. Much of that, if it s not composted, ends up in landfills where it decays, sending potent planet-warming greenhouse gases into the atmosphere. Enter a new business opportunity. A company called Winnow has developed the AI tool that spies on restaurant garbage. Another, company, Afresh, digests supermarket data to look for wasteful mismatches between what a store is stocking, and what people are buying. ....
If nothing is done to reduce wastage, Malaysia would waste about 15 to 20 per cent more food during Ramadan compared with other months, according to a government agency. ....
NGOs and government agencies in Malaysia are concerned about an issue that has become more glaring during the holy month of Ramadan - excess food being left unsold at bazaars across the country.
